[0044] The present invention will be described in detail below in conjunction with specific embodiments: a kind of ECG waveform fast compression algorithm that is applicable to realizing real-time transmission in embedded hardware, described fast compression algorithm comprises the following steps:
[0045] S1: In view of the ECG waveform has a certain change law, and a large number of data points are based on the vicinity of the baseline, so the data is subjected to a differential compression and a double statistical coding compression;
[0046] S2: Before the actual compression, group the collected ECG waveform data according to a fixed time period, first calculate the compression value Ci of the primary compression and the secondary compression of each group of data, and compare the compression value C2 of the secondary compression with A heavy compression value C1;
